Product-moment
A statistical measure of the linear correlation between two variables, often expressed as Pearson's correlation coefficient.
Scatterplot
A type of graph used in statistics to display values for two variables for a set of data, showing the relationship between them.
R(xy)
A statistical measure representing the strength and direction of a linear relationship between two variables.
Descriptive Statistics
Statistical methods that summarize and describe the features of a set of data.
